Storm Risk Analysis
Bauple Forest in Queensland falls within a wind region classified under AS/NZS 1170.2, the Australian/New Zealand standard for structural design actions for wind. Wind regions range from A (lowest) to D (most severe — tropical cyclone-prone areas), and the applicable wind classification affects building design requirements for new construction in Bauple Forest.
Severe thunderstorms in Bauple Forest can bring damaging wind gusts, large hail, and intense rainfall. The Bureau of Meteorology issues severe weather warnings for Queensland, and historical storm data shows that properties in Bauple Forest may be exposed to these events depending on local geography and storm track patterns.
CSIRO research indicates that the intensity of severe convective storms — including those producing hail and damaging winds — may increase in a warming climate, though the precise local effects for Bauple Forest depend on regional atmospheric conditions. What storm mitigation measures should Bauple Forest property owners consider?
Storm mitigation includes impact-resistant roofing materials, cyclone-rated fixings where required, window and door shutters, regular roof and gutter maintenance, securing outdoor items, and checking that your property complies with current wind load standards under the National Construction Code.
